Anthony  Bourdain is an American chef, author and television personality. He is the host of Travel Channel’s culinary and cultural adventure programs Anthony Bourdain: No Reservations . Anthony’s wife Ottavia is a rising star on the Brazilian jiu jitsu circuit. She trains at Renzo Gracie academy in New York . Although she is still a white belt, her recent competition matches and her dedication to hard training have made her into very promising prospect.

In this episode of the TV show No Reservations, Anthony and Ottavia go to Rio de Janeiro and experience the Jiu-Jitsu lifestyle. Ottavia has a superfight with a Gracie Barra female fighter and they have dinner with Rolls Gracie’s widow (Igor Gracie’s mother). Great episode!
